Transaction 53049683709782c3ef1a510e31bd594a933935b3b78431c0208545aef22a3be6
1 Input
1 Output
-
53049683709782c3ef1a510e31bd594a933935b3b78431c0208545aef22a3be6:0
- value
- 183020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37dec70f9ba7773e36c4e76a0477b84d699d53d5 OP_EQUAL
- address
- 36nRxxBPWhbcNxjBtUCNnFzbdwzBpGD5XG